Sunaofe Morph Classic Review: $449.99, Fit & Returns
The Morph Classic is the lower-priced Sunaofe Morph route with a published $449.99 sale snapshot, auto-tracking lumbar language, 7D armrests, and a recline angle up to 140°. The purchase decision turns on your measurements and the exact dispatch message shown for your configuration.
Price checked September 4, 2026: $449.99 sale snapshot vs. $699.99 regular-price reference. Price, stock, shipping, and configuration can change.

What the mechanism claims mean
Useful controls on paper; personal fit still decides the purchase.
Auto-tracking lumbar
Sunaofe says the dynamic lumbar system tracks the spine over 3.5 inches and gives a seven-level dial. The page does not show a test method or map every measurement to a separate axis.
Armrest movement
The listing describes 7D adjustable arms with 360° freedom and flip-up behavior. Ask for the missing clearance measurements if your desk or keyboard tray is tight.
Recline range
Sunaofe lists five locking positions and auto-tension up to 140°. That answers the advertised range, not how the locks feel or whether the angle suits your preferred work posture.

Returns
A trial window with strict packaging conditions.
For eligible orders placed on or after March 25, 2026, Sunaofe describes a 60-Day Comfort Trial with complimentary return shipping. The chair must be disassembled and sent back with all parts and accessories in the original box and protective materials. Missing packaging can mean a declined return or a 20–30% repacking fee.
Warranty
Five years for qualifying product defects.
Sunaofe lists a limited five-year warranty for structural and mechanical integrity or manufacturing defects under normal use. That boundary can protect against qualifying product failures; it does not guarantee a body fit, comfort, or a medical result. Review the exclusions before relying on it.

What are the Sunaofe Morph Classic dimensions?+
Sunaofe lists the chair at 48 inches high by 27¾ inches wide by 26¾ inches deep, with an adjustable seat height of 18–21.8 inches. The product page does not clearly publish a complete usable seat-depth or seat-width measurement, so overall depth is not a substitute for measuring your body and desk.
What does the Morph Classic auto-tracking lumbar system do?+
Sunaofe describes a dynamic lumbar system that tracks the spine over 3.5 inches. The same feature block lists a rotating lumbar dial with seven levels and a 3.1-inch depth figure. The page does not clearly define those numbers as independent height and depth axes, and there is no WorkChoose pressure or comfort test. No medical outcome should be inferred.
Does the Morph Classic have 7D armrests?+
Yes. Sunaofe lists 7D adjustable armrests and describes 360-degree movement with flip-up behavior. Numeric minimum and maximum positions, folded height, and exact outer-width clearance are not clearly supplied on the product page. Measure the desk opening if the arms must clear it.
How far does the Morph Classic recline?+
Sunaofe lists a recline angle of up to 140 degrees with five locking positions and auto-tension language. Those are published mechanism claims. WorkChoose did not test lock feel, required force, stability, noise, or comfort at each position.
